Quarterly Planning Note — Sales Leads

Warranty costs on the Brindlecore range ran 22% over plan this quarter, mostly from early-batch motor failures. Service has a fix in production; affected units ship replacement kits from the Oakstead depot. Factor extended service conversations into renewal calls, and flag any accounts threatening escalation. Pricing adjustments are under review. Our response plan is set out below.

board note of yadup-fajef: Druiusox Holdings is in early talks to buy Norwynek Systems for about $186.0 million. The Kaseth launch date is June 24, and nothing goes to the press before then. Legal wants the Quenethek Group term sheet withdrawn before November 27.

Team — cut-over for the Ledgerline dedup job finished last night. Old matcher is retired; the new fuzzy-match pipeline now owns all customer record merges. Roughly 12k duplicates collapsed on the first full pass, zero rollbacks needed. Known gap: hyphenated surnames still score low, fix queued for next sprint. Don't re-enable the legacy merge flag under any circumstances — it will double-write. Everything you need to run the pipeline locally is in the repo, and the production service currently runs with the configuration below.

deployment values, yadug-bawif:
[framir]
team = pelox
access_code = ac_a38ab2
owner = tamion.julael
host = framir.tolvaqlabs.test
port = 11211
peer = tammir.zemvargrid.local
salt = 2215ef03
pin = 1541

Subject: DR drill — Pinwick cron drift

Team: Thursday's drill simulates the cron drift we saw on the Pinwick schedulers. You'll restore the drift-audit database from cold backup and replay two days of job logs. Follow the steps in the drill doc exactly. The restore tool will prompt once for the recovery passphrase, which appears immediately below.

vault phrase of yahap-kajof = fraath-ralael